Anna I. Proietto is a scholar working on Immunology, Oncology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Anna I. Proietto has authored 20 papers receiving a total of 2.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Immunology, 3 papers in Oncology and 1 paper in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Anna I. Proietto's work include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(17 papers), T-cell and B-cell Immunology (15 papers) and Immune Cell Function and Interaction (8 papers). Anna I. Proietto is often cited by papers focused on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(17 papers), T-cell and B-cell Immunology (15 papers) and Immune Cell Function and Interaction (8 papers). Anna I. Proietto collaborates with scholars based in Australia, Netherlands and Japan. Anna I. Proietto's co-authors include Li Wu, Ken Shortman, Meredith O’Keeffe, Shalin H. Naik, Mireille H. Lahoud, Jóse A. Villadangos, William R. Heath, Petra Schnorrer, Priyanka Sathe and Hae‐Young Park and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, The Journal of Experimental Medicine and Blood.
